SPECTROGRAPHIC ANALYSIS OF SMALL AMOUNT OF RARE EARTHS IN ALLOY STEEL |

Abstract Adding small amount of rare earth elements in alloy steel will improve its certain mechanicalproperties. Direct spectrographic determination of residual rare earth in steel has been generallyregarded as impossible since the complex spectra of the major components of ten prevented the identi-fication and measurement of the weak rare earth lines. In this work the chemico-spectrochemical method is employed. The mercury cathode separ-ation and the ether extraction technique were used for the concentration of R. E. proceeding thespectrographic procedure. Yttrium or thorium is used as carrier and internal standard. The concentrated sample solution is droped on the tip of spectra pure carbon electrodes. A.C. arc (-1)is used to excite the spectra. This method permits the determination of as little as 50 γ of total rare earths in 1 gram sampleof steel with an error of±10%.
